oracle遇到的問題,Oracle數(shù)據(jù)庫常見問題及解決方法
Oracle數(shù)據(jù)庫常見問題及解決方法

Oracle數(shù)據(jù)庫作為全球最流行的關(guān)系型數(shù)據(jù)庫之一,在企業(yè)級(jí)應(yīng)用中扮演著至關(guān)重要的角色。在使用過程中,用戶可能會(huì)遇到各種問題。本文將針對(duì)一些常見的Oracle數(shù)據(jù)庫問題進(jìn)行分析,并提供相應(yīng)的解決方法。
標(biāo)簽:Oracle數(shù)據(jù)庫連接問題

當(dāng)用戶嘗試連接Oracle數(shù)據(jù)庫時(shí),可能會(huì)遇到ORA-12541錯(cuò)誤,這通常意味著監(jiān)聽器沒有啟動(dòng)或者監(jiān)聽器配置不正確。
解決方法:
檢查監(jiān)聽器是否已啟動(dòng),可以使用命令`lsrcl saus`進(jìn)行查看。
確保監(jiān)聽器配置文件(liseer.ora)中的參數(shù)正確無誤。
重啟監(jiān)聽器,使用命令`lsrcl sar`。
標(biāo)簽:Oracle數(shù)據(jù)庫性能問題

當(dāng)SQL語句執(zhí)行緩慢時(shí),可能是因?yàn)樗饕笔?、查詢?yōu)化不當(dāng)或數(shù)據(jù)量過大等原因。
解決方法:
檢查索引是否已創(chuàng)建,并確保索引覆蓋了查詢條件。
優(yōu)化SQL語句,避免使用SELECT ,盡量使用具體的字段。
對(duì)數(shù)據(jù)庫進(jìn)行分區(qū),以減少查詢數(shù)據(jù)量。
使用EXPLAI PLA分析SQL語句的執(zhí)行計(jì)劃,找出性能瓶頸。
標(biāo)簽:Oracle數(shù)據(jù)庫空間問題

當(dāng)表空間空間不足時(shí),可能會(huì)導(dǎo)致數(shù)據(jù)庫無法正常寫入數(shù)據(jù),甚至出現(xiàn)ORA-1555錯(cuò)誤。
解決方法:
檢查表空間使用情況,使用命令`SELECT ablespace_ame, oal_space, used_space, free_space FROM dba_daa_files;`。
擴(kuò)展表空間,可以使用ALTER TABLESPACE命令。
刪除不再需要的表或數(shù)據(jù),釋放空間。
對(duì)表進(jìn)行分區(qū),以分散數(shù)據(jù),減少單個(gè)表空間的空間壓力。
標(biāo)簽:Oracle數(shù)據(jù)庫備份與恢復(fù)問題

備份失敗可能是由于備份策略不正確、備份介質(zhì)故障或備份命令錯(cuò)誤等原因。
解決方法:
檢查備份策略,確保備份計(jì)劃合理。
檢查備份介質(zhì),確保其正常工作。
檢查備份命令,確保語法正確。
嘗試使用不同的備份工具或命令。
標(biāo)簽:Oracle數(shù)據(jù)庫安全性問題

數(shù)據(jù)庫被非法訪問可能是由于權(quán)限設(shè)置不當(dāng)、密碼強(qiáng)度不足或安全策略缺失等原因。
解決方法:
檢查數(shù)據(jù)庫權(quán)限設(shè)置,確保權(quán)限合理分配。
設(shè)置強(qiáng)密碼策略,要求用戶使用復(fù)雜密碼。
定期檢查數(shù)據(jù)庫安全日志,發(fā)現(xiàn)異常行為及時(shí)處理。
啟用數(shù)據(jù)庫審計(jì)功能,記錄用戶操作。

Oracle數(shù)據(jù)庫在運(yùn)行過程中可能會(huì)遇到各種問題,但只要掌握正確的解決方法,大多數(shù)問題都可以得到有效解決。本文針對(duì)一些常見的Oracle數(shù)據(jù)庫問題進(jìn)行了分析,并提供了相應(yīng)的解決方法,希望對(duì)廣大Oracle數(shù)據(jù)庫用戶有所幫助。
本站所有文章、數(shù)據(jù)、圖片均來自互聯(lián)網(wǎng),一切版權(quán)均歸源網(wǎng)站或源作者所有。
如果侵犯了你的權(quán)益請(qǐng)來信告知我們刪除。郵箱: